Built using high-grade stainless 304 steel and CNC mandrel-bent pipework, our exhaust ensures a perfect fit and long-lasting performance that can handle everything the British climate throws at it. The mandrel-bending process is crucial here: unlike crush-bent pipes, mandrel bending maintains a consistent internal diameter throughout every curve and angle, allowing exhaust gases to flow freely and efficiently. This translates directly into sharper throttle response, improved power delivery, and that unmistakable deep, purposeful roar that reminds you exactly why you bought an Italian V-twin in the first place.

This exhaust is designed exclusively for the aprilia rsv 1000 mille 1998-2003 model range, covering all variants produced during this five-year production run. That includes the standard Mille, the higher-specification Mille R with its premium Öhlins suspension and forged wheels, and even the ultra-rare SP homologation special developed in collaboration with Cosworth. It is not a universal fit, and that’s precisely the point — by manufacturing to exact specifications for this particular bike, we can guarantee proper, secure fitment that looks factory-standard once installed, even though it’s anything but standard in terms of sound and performance.

The Aprilia RSV Mille was a sport motorcycle manufactured by Aprilia from 1998 to 2003. It was offered in three versions, RSV Mille, RSV Mille R, and RSV Mille SP.

The first RSV Mille (ME) was made from 1998 to 2000, the updated RSV Mille (RP) from 2001 to 2002 and the last update was made in 2003.

With a 998 cc 60-degree V-twin engine built by the Austrian company Rotax, the RSV Mille was the first large displacement motorcycle made by Aprilia that up to then had made up to 250cc engines.[3] This same engine was used unmodified in the Tuono and in slightly modified form in the SL1000 Falco.

The Mille featured a type of slipper clutch, which worked by using a vacuum on a closed throttle from the inlet manifold to give the effect of slipper clutch but only on a closed throttle.
